At Sancorp we’re committed to delivering transparent fee for service advice. That means that our clients pay our network specialists for the time and advice they provide. We don’t receive any commissions, which gives our clients the confidence that they are receiving objective advice. How much does a Financial plan / Property Investment plan cost? Each plan our network of specialists create is based on a deep understanding of your personal circumstances. Your plan will be completely tailored to your personal circumstances, and the cost of your plan will be dependent on factors such as:
TIME
The comprehensive process includes multiple face-to-face meetings, in addition to the time taken by the planner and the support team to research, model and develop your plan. This may also include things like liaising with your accountant or lawyer (or setting you up with one if you don’t have), obtaining your financial records, detailed product comparisons to identify the most suitable products for you or for your investment, financial forecasting and the preparation of the plan.
COMPLEXITY
Some clients have very simple financial affairs, while others may have multiple investment properties, family trusts and other more complex investment requirements. The level of complexity of your circumstances will have an impact on the fee charged per hour required to develop your plan.
Based on the complexity of your plan, our network of specialists’ Investment / Financial planning consultation fee ranging from $250 – $600 per hour. They offer a FREE ONE-HOUR INITIAL MEETING as their way of being confident in their services. We want our clients to experience the difference and feel secure about our specialists’ advices.
Please note a Free One-Hour Initial Meeting does not apply for appointments with Sancorp’s CEO & Director (Suri Angelos N. & Takumi Takahashi). Their fees range from $1,200 – $1,800 per hour based on the complexity of the property development.
